Will a refund be given if the trademark registration is unsuccessful?

Whether a refund will be issued if the trademark registration is unsuccessful depends on the policies of the specific trademark registration agency or organization.

In some cases, if a trademark registration application is rejected or fails to successfully pass review, the trademark registration agency may refund part or all of the registration fee in accordance with its policies. This usually depends on the specific circumstances of the applicant’s eligibility for a refund.

However, some trademark registration agencies or organizations stipulate that the registration fee is non-refundable regardless of whether the trademark registration is successful or not. This means that even if the trademark registration application is unsuccessful, the registration fee will not be refunded.

Therefore, if you are considering applying for trademark registration and want to know the refund policy, it is recommended that you read the relevant policies and regulations of the trademark registration agency or organization in detail before submitting the registration application to understand the conditions and requirements for refund.

Please note that specific policies and regulations for trademark registration may vary from country to country. When applying for trademark registration, it is recommended that you consult your local trademark registration agency, professional advisor or lawyer to obtain accurate and up-to-date refund information.
